Phase Resolved X-Ray Spectral Analysis of Intermediate Polars EX Hya and FO Aqr
Intermediate Polars (IPs): EX Hya and FO Aqr whichs are a subclass of Cataclysmic Variables (CVs) where a white dwarf with magnetic field strength of about 1-10MG accretes material from a main sequence companion through a truncated disc.

Tearing up a misaligned accretion disc with a binary companion [PDF]
Accretion discs are common in binary systems, and they are often found to be misaligned with respect to the binary orbit. The gravitational torque from a companion induces nodal precession in misaligned disc orbits.
